Soldiers of the 116th MET prepare for federal mobilization
Virginia National Guard Soldiers of the Staunton-based 116th Military Engagement Team prepare for their upcoming federal mobilization during annual training at Fort Pickett, Virginia, held Feb. 15 - March 5, 2016. During the annual training period, Soldiers of the 116th MET were issued new equipment, brushed up on their combatives skills, went through rollover training and conducted classroom training. During their federal mobilization, the 116th MET will conduct military-to-military engagements with partners in U.S. Army Central Command’s area of responsibility including Kuwait, Jordan, Oman and Tajikistan.
